Israeli Actress Dror Zuzovsky Opens Up About Hollywood Success and Personal Life
Dror Zuzovsky, an Israeli actress who has recently worked alongside Hollywood heavyweights such as Martin Scorsese, revealed her admiration for actor Danny DeVito, citing his film 'Matilda' as a formative influence from her childhood. She recounted meeting DeVito on the set of the film 'The Survivor' five years ago and shared a childhood memory of trying to move a tree with her mind after watching 'Matilda'.
At 35, Zuzovsky has built a successful international career, balancing roles in the US, UK, and Israel. She recently completed filming an HBO pilot with Joshua Jackson, Ray Romano, and Rita Wilson, and starred in Scorsese's docudrama series 'The Saints' as well as the miniseries 'The Missing' alongside her partner, British actor Sam Claflin. In Israel, she won the Best Performance award at the 2023 Cannes International Series Festival for her role in 'Corduroy' and is currently promoting the short film 'Big Pepe', which she also produced.
Zuzovsky moved to Los Angeles two years ago to pursue her Hollywood ambitions, enduring numerous auditions before landing roles. She emphasized perseverance as key to success and noted that despite the challenges Israeli actors face abroad, including after October 7, she personally has not felt a decline in opportunities.
Her personal life has evolved significantly; after past relationships including one with a woman, she is now in a stable relationship with Claflin, whom she met on the set of 'The Missing'. They have been together for ten months and are exploring their future, including the possibility of marriage and children. Zuzovsky expressed a desire to become a mother, saying, "I would like to be a mom, God willing."
Spiritually, Zuzovsky identifies as a believer deeply connected to Judaism and metaphysical interests. She studies Kabbalah, observes Jewish traditions such as Shabbat and Yom Kippur, and finds faith to be an anchor amid her nomadic lifestyle. She also enjoys sharing Israeli culture with Claflin, who has visited Israel twice and learned some Hebrew phrases.
